Double knockout (KO)

Video games; Fighting games

Double Knockouts occur when both players manage to deplete each others lifebars at the same time, usually causing a draw.

Frame

Video games; Fighting games

A frame is a single animation still. As video games run at either 50 or 60 frames per second, attacks can be precisely calculated in terms of the number of frames they take to execute.

Damage scaling

Video games; Fighting games

A system that alters the base damage of an attack for a number of reasons. For example, successive attacks in a combo may get progressively weaker.

Guard metre

Video games; Fighting games

A slowly recharging gauge that depletes whenever a character blocks an attack. If the gauge becomes depleted the player will suffer a guard break.
